Wellesley election results in & none of those running unopposed lost. Whew!

The Wellesley Town Clerk has released preliminary results for Tuesday’s election, with no surprises in the uncontested town-wide categories but a few close races for Town Meeting seats, including one three-way tie. Seven percent of registered voters turned out at the polls, including the cozy Precinct G polling place nestled among the DVDs and CDs at Wellesley Free Library.

Among those getting Town Meeting seats: Teenager Matt Jablonski, who we wrote about a couple of weeks back, and fellow teen Jonathan Fink.

Radio guy Howie Carr got 1 write-in vote, so that should give him something to write about for his Boston Herald column.
